Вычислительные комплексы.



Многомашинные вычислительные комплексы (ММВК) – связь между ЭВМ, входящих в них, могла быть косвенной (через другие устройства) или прямой (через адаптер). Косвенная связь обеспечивается через общие внешние запоминающие устройства. Всё происходит за счет доступа к общим наборам данных. Подобная связь эффективна только тогда, когда ЭВМ взаимодействуют достаточно редко. Более оперативное взаимодействие достигается за счет прямой связи через адаптеры. Эти адаптеры обеспечивают обмен через каналы ввода/вывода. За счет этого повышается оперативность обмена данными, что позволяет вести параллельно процессы обработки. В ММВК взаимодействие процессов обработки данных обеспечивается только за счет обмена сигналами прерывания и передачи данных через адаптеры или общие внешние запоминающие устройства. Лучшие условия для взаимодействия процессоров – это когда все процессоры имеют доступ ко всему объему данных, хранимых в ОЗУ, и могут взаимодействовать со всеми периферийными устройствами комплекса.

П – процессор

МП – модуль памяти

Квв – канал ввода/вывода

ПУ – периферийное устройство.

Вычислительный комплекс со многими процессорами и общей оперативной памятью называется многопроцессорным. В многопроцессорной комплексе отказы отдельных устройств влияют на работоспособность СОД в меньшей степени, то есть они обладают большей устойчивостью к отказам.

Многопроцессорные вычислительные комплексы рассматриваются как базовые элементы для СОД различного назначения. Поэтому в состав ВК принято включать только технические средства и общесистемное (базовое) ПО. Вычислительный комплекс (ВК) – это совокупность средств, включающая в себя несколько ЭВМ или процессоров и общесистемное ПО. ВК – СОД, настроенная на решение задачи конкретной области применения – называется вычислительной системой, то есть совокупности технических средств и ПО, ориентированных на решение определенной совокупности задач. Существует 2 способа ориентации: вычислительная система может строиться на основе ЭВМ или ВК общего применения и ориентация системы обеспечивается за счет программных средств: ОС и прикладные программы; ориентация на заданный класс задач может достигаться за счет использования специализированных ЭВМ и ВК, в этом случае удается при умеренных затратах оборудования добиться высокой производительности. Специализированные вычислительные системы (ВС) наиболее широко используются для решения задач векторной и матричной алгебры, интегрированием и дифференцированием уравнений, обработки изображений, распознаванию образов. Первые ВС были простроены на основе специализированных комплексов, то есть были разработаны процессоры со специализированными системами команд, и конфигурация комплексов жестко ориентировалась на конкретный класс задач.

Адаптивные ВС самостоятельно приспосабливаются к решаемым задачам, причем адаптация достигается за счет изменения конфигурации системы, при этом соединения между модулями памяти, процессорами, периферией осуществляются динамически на текущий момент времени. Их часто называют системами с динамической структурой. Динамическая настройка может происходить в течение длительного времени.

 


Дата добавления: 2015-12-17; просмотров: 29; Мы поможем в написании вашей работы!

Поделиться с друзьями:






Мы поможем в написании ваших работ!